OoC: Clive appears in both Suikoden and Suikoden 2. In Suikoden 2 he has a huge story event that revolves around him searching for Elza. Unfortunately it is timed. You literally have to get to certain areas within certain time frames to initiate an event. I think the final one, near the games end, has to be made within 12 hours. So, there's no room for you to do any of the side events or recruit other characters (all this can take 50+ hours). You have to speed run it.
